## ChipGate Reader — Approval Process

The ChipGate RFID reader at the Harlowe Bay Marathon finish line runs firmware that must never be flashed mid-event. Any firmware or antenna-gain change requires written approval at least 48 hours before race day, plus a dry-run against the Pacewick simulator. On-call engineers may restart the reader service without approval, but config edits under /etc/chipgate/ are locked. If a change cannot wait, escalate immediately. Final approval for all race-day changes rests with the person named below.

named custodian: Brivan Eliath Quenox Frador

**Q: My plugin's parity results differ from the Tarnlight dashboard. Who do I contact?**

First, confirm you're querying the same rate snapshot; Tarnlight caches results for ten minutes. Check your plugin's region filter — mismatched regions cause most discrepancies. Review the plugin author guide's troubleshooting section. If results still diverge after a cache flush and region check, file a report with the Tarnlight integrations team at the address below.

billing contact of yawip-yadup = druath.casdor@nelvrolabs.internal

Audit item 14 — FeeLoom rules engine

Verify shipping-fee rules in FeeLoom match the published rate card. Check zone mappings, weight tiers, and holiday surcharge toggles. Confirm last quarter's deprecated rules are disabled, not just hidden. Support: log any mismatches with order examples; do not hotfix rules yourself. All discrepancies require written sign-off before correction. Sign-off authority rests with the engine owner, named below.

named custodian: Belius Casath Ulaix Sorius

**Review comment on `scheduler/drift_guard.py`**

Good catch isolating the drift to NTP step corrections on the Harvane workers. One request before approval: please document why the tolerance window is asymmetric — new folks reading this will assume it's a typo. Also note that the sampler runs more often right after a detected step, which is why two intervals appear. Since these constants interact, reviewers should see them together in one place. For reference, the values as merged are.

tuning constants:
QUOTAS = {
    "quenael": 10,
    "oliwyn": 1,
}